My impressions comparing Flux.2 Klein 4B (6-bit) and Flux.2 Klein 9B (6-bit).
Until now, I've been using Flux.2 Klein 4B (6-bit) because my Mac was not very powerful, and I was amazed at how fast it was. Although it was slightly inferior in some anatomical aspects, I was satisfied with the speed.
I then tried Flux.2 Klein 9B (6-bit), and although the generation time was twice as long, the generated images were tolerable.
My conclusion is that I should use 4B for test generation, and then use 9B once I'm satisfied with the prompt.
Personally, I prefer it to Qwen.
The editing functions are also excellent, and I was able to get satisfactory results even when continuing to edit on the canvas without using a mood board.
When I first started using DT, I exclusively used ZIT, but now I exclusively use Flux.2 Klein 9B!

Using Draw Things w/ Z‑Image Turbo on Mac mini M4 (32 GB RAM, models on external SSD) and running into a weird issue that didn't exist at first. When I first got the Mac and installed Draw Things, Z‑Image Turbo worked perfectly using the recommended settings and default workflow, but now whenever I generate with Z‑Image Turbo 1.0 (both 6‑bit and full versions) the canvas turns something like solid gray, then solid black, and the final result is just a blank/transparent image, even though other SDXL and SD1.5 models still work fine on the same setup. Also get the same result with any Flux models. I've paid particular attention to using the right samplers. I’ve already tried brand‑new projects with “Use recommended settings,” different samplers, redownloading models, cache resets, and updating Draw Things, but nothing fixes this gray→black→blank/transparent outcome.
Has anyone else had Z‑Image Turbo in Draw Things go from “used to work fine” to this specific gray→black→blank/transparent behavior, and is there a known workaround or setting combo that actually fixes the blank output? I've tried messing around with this for the past several weeks to no avail.
